Our History

Albrite Lighting first opened its doors in Victoria in 1970. Partners Jack and Mark Zabel & Don Graham were one of the first Western Canadian suppliers of, the then new, long-life incandescent light bulbs. Quickly realizing that there was demand for a full line lamp wholesaler in the commercial and property management industries in Victoria, Albrite added fluorescent lamps and ballasts to their product mix.

Soon after, Albrite opened its first branch on the Mainland, in North Vancouver. As the only true lamp wholesaler in the area, growth was swift and Albrite moved to larger premises in Burnaby. During this time, Albrite also briefly operated a location in Seattle. As the business grew, so too did the product line and, Albrite added fluorescent fixtures to their product offering in the late 1970s.

In 1980 Don Graham sold his shares in Albrite to the Zabel brothers. Soon after, Albrite bought Canadian Securex, a janitorial and lighting supply company. In the early 1980s Albrite also began supplying HID fixtures and experienced growth across many sectors including industrial and property management as well as sales to electrical contractors.

During the early 1990s, Jack and Mark Zabel made the decision to retire and sell their interests in the company to their respective children. The infusion of new blood and youthful energy had a profound impact on the company and sales growth was significant. In 1993 Albrite Vancouver once again outgrew its premises and moved to its current location in Port Coquitlam.

In 2001 Albrite opened a branch in Grande Prairie, Alberta to capitalize on the lucrative oil industry. Sales growth was steady and the operation was quite a success, however the branch was closed in 2007 to focus on continued success in our key markets.

In July of 2009, Wayne Zabel bought out his final partner and for the first time in its 40 year history, Albrite Lighting has a single shareholder. Albrite Lighting has recently embarked on a large scale corporate rejuvenation project aimed at poising company for continued growth and a strong future. Next time you are at your local Albrite branch you will notice all sorts of changes, such as: a new logo, a new website, improved business operating systems and inventory control and a more consistent brand image.
